The Jewish National Fund has paid former US president Bill Clinton $500,000 for a 45-minute speech at the Peres Academic Center in Rehovot on June 17 in honor of the Israeli president’s 90th birthday. Guests were last week sent invitations requiring them to stump up NIS 3,000 (just over $800) apiece to attend the gala dinner, and thus to help cover his fee, but that requirement has now been canceled. The fee is not destined for Clinton’s personal account, but will rather be paid to the William J. Clinton Foundation, which encourages awareness of environmental protection and public health along with projects promoting those causes. http://www.timesofisrael.com/jnf-to-pay-bill-clinton-500000-for-45-minute-talk/
